About Median Age
Grenada County, Mississippi has a median age of 39.2 years, ranking #2,336 of 3,222 counties nationwide — 0.8% above the national value of 38.9 years. Within Mississippi, it ranks #49 of 82. This places it in the 28th percentile nationally.
The median age of the total population.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ey 2024 5-Year Estimates. All values are estimates derived from survey samples and are subject to margin of error. For more information, see our methodology.
